## Account Recovery — Trailnote Offline Mode

When a surveyor's Trailnote app has been offline for 30+ days, their local credentials expire and sync refuses to resume. Don't make them wipe the device — all their unsynced field data lives there! Instead, open the support console, pick "Offline Reinstate," and enter their handle. The console will ask for the support team's shared recovery passphrase before issuing a reinstatement token. Use the one below.

unlock words, bagaf-fajeg: zorael-kelax-fraath-quenix-eliok-sileth-aldmir-wenir-druiel

At end of lease, all Quillmark laptops are wiped by IT, tagged, and palletised at dock 4. Counts must match the return manifest before shrink-wrapping; any discrepancy goes to the asset desk before release. The lessor, Ardenne Leasing, sends its own contracted courier, usually midweek. Do not release pallets to any other carrier, even if paperwork looks plausible. Photograph the sealed pallet before loading. When the Ardenne driver checks in, pass on the following hand-over instruction verbatim:

dispatch memo: the eliok quenok courier leaves the sorael aldath belion tammir casix gileth queniel jorath ledger at gate 9299 under passcode 897989

Ticket: Config drift on waveform preview nodes

The Soundmere waveform preview service is rendering at different resolutions across the three production nodes. Node B was patched manually during last month's incident and never reconciled, so previews from it look coarser and cache keys don't match, causing duplicate renders. Please schedule a redeploy from the canonical manifest this week. For reference, the intended configuration is recorded below.

settings of tagef-bawif:
DRUIX_HOST=druix.zemvarlabs.internal
DRUIX_PORT=8000